Something like
"Go to the castle.
Escort the gnomes.
Defeat the invading lizardons. (Horrible idea btw, starting with the meanest enemies on Graal...if I were to redo Classic from scratch, it'd start with enemy soldiers).
Return to the castle.
Go to Babord.
Find the barrel.
Buy the fishing rod.
Go to Avalon.
Fish out the conch shell.
Disable the earthquake machine..."

You know, quests. Quests can themselves be primarily "ZOMG A WAVE OF BADDIES!" for the most part, provided they Have baddies and there's some end to defeating them (even if it's just Hey look, a door opened). If you have a Quest, you can have puzzles, bosses, mazes, key-hunts, secret rooms...a game, in other words.
For the most part we just have expanded PK Arenas now.
